Job Description:

The Enterprise Architecture and Data and Analytics (EADA) department is a centralized, multi-disciplinary team at Nestle Purina Pet Care driving the company’s data and analytics evolution. As an Expert Business Analyst for Retail Data Analytics, you will be embedded in our Product Management Practice, working within the Customer Product Team to deliver transformational data products that support go-to-market sales strategies and marketing efforts, with a specialized focus on retailer data insights

Job Responsibility:

  • Collect, examine, and shape requirements for retailer data insights across a broad base of stakeholders in sales and marketing to enable data engineers to develop data products
  • Analyze retailer and ecommerce data from platforms such as Crisp, Retail Link, Nielsen, IRI, Stackline, or similar, to uncover actionable insights that drive sales and marketing strategies
  • Collaborate with Product Owner, Scrum Master, Lead Data Engineer, development team, and key stakeholders to ensure retailer data needs are identified, conceptualized, and documented
  • Facilitate discussions with sales, marketing, and business partners to harvest core business needs related to retailer data
  • Translate business requirements into technical specifications for data products focused on retailer insights
  • Enhance end user satisfaction by continuously improving usability and relevance of retailer data products
  • Participate in agile ceremonies and Product Owner’s Guild sessions, ensuring retailer data insights are prioritized in the backlog

Requirements: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Computer Science, Information Systems, or related field
  • 5+ years of experience in business analysis or project management gathering business requirements and writing user stories
  • 3+ years of experience with business analysis techniques such as business process modeling or process flows
  • 3+ years of experience working with customer, retail, sales, or eCommerce data performing data analysis, data modeling, or data mapping

Nice to have:

  • Experience with Agile or SAFe delivery practices and Agile ceremonies
  • Experience with Microsoft Power Platforms, Azure DevOps, and SQL
